Output 43702397a9770cd72864cd47527a9a18dfc8092dcd5b4b7f71ddcb049849c881:1

value
13400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cedb77f84ec146de340954ea34fa57a1538036 OP_EQUAL
address
3CXDTsp3wuSzNBHBmSyK2ggE4iQguPzCjF
transaction
43702397a9770cd72864cd47527a9a18dfc8092dcd5b4b7f71ddcb049849c881
confirmations
319305
spent
true